100 players simultaneously decide whether to choose road A or road B. Each driver wishes to minimize the cost of travel. If a driver takes Road A, his cost is three times the number of cars on road A. If he chooses road B, he has to pay a toll of $20 plus he incurs a cost equal to the number of drivers choosing road B. A Nash equilibrium outcome is: (a) All 100 players choose A. (b) All 100 players choose B. (c) 64 choose B and 36 choose A. 1 (d) 30 choose A and 70 choose B
